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Netzwerke (https://www.delphipraxis.net/14-netzwerke/)
-   -   Delphi [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t (https://www.delphipraxis.net/164060-%5Bdcc-fataler-fehler%5D-e2202-package-indycore-wird-benoetigt.html)

LeisureSuitLarry 27. Okt 2011 11:27

[D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Liste der Anhänge anzeigen (Anzahl: 1)
Hallo beieinander,
ich hole mir von ftp://indy.fulgan.com/ZIP/ die aktuelle Indy-Version (4690) und installiere sie nach Delphi 2010 Indy aktualisieren (v2.0).

Installation funktioniert prima, aber wenn man Indy dann in einem Projekt verwenden will, kommt o. g. Fehlermeldung.

Die Einstellung unter Tools/Optionen/Delpi-Optionen/Bibliothek - Win32 habe ich angehängt.

Liegt es an der Indy-Version oder mache ich was falsch?

Manfred

alphaflight83 27. Okt 2011 13:44

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Dein Link zum Vorgehen funktioniert leider nicht, aber schau dir mal die
Anleitung von Assertor (#8) an, vielleicht erklärt das schon den Fehler.
Alternativ: Indy Update unter Delphi 2009
Grundsätzlich müssen in der Library natürlich die richtigen (evtl. neuen) Source-Pfade angegeben sein.

LeisureSuitLarry 27. Okt 2011 14:48

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Erst mal danke ich dir für deine Antwort.

Der richtige Link lautet http://www.herrotto.de/delphiindy/. Bisher hat es ja auch funktioniert.

Wie man im Anhang sehen konnte, hatte ich die Pfade korrekt eigestellt. Habe sogar IndyCore140.bpl in mehrere "Suchpfade" kopiert.

alphaflight83 28. Okt 2011 08:45

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Wie gesagt, ich lege die Updates nicht an die alten Stellen, sondern wie von Assertor vorgeschlagen in einem eigenen kompletten Ordner
(Bei mir direkt unter $(BDS)), das alte Zeug hab ich komplett gelöscht.
Dadurch kann ich dann die aktuelle Version mit SVN auschecken und die Ordnerstruktur lassen wie sie ist.

Das Wichtigste beim Update ist die Reihenfolge beim Kompilieren und Installieren,
danach das Anlegen der Pfade (z.B. $(BDS)\Indy\Lib\System ...\Core ...\Protocols)
Hatte nach den Unklarheiten damals keinerlei Probleme mehr mit dem Update.

Wenn du aber nach deiner Anleitung alles richtig und in der angegebenen Reihenfolge gemacht hast, sollte das genauso gut funktionieren ...

PS: evtl. bringt auch dieser Newsgroupeintrag etwas

LeisureSuitLarry 28. Okt 2011 10:22

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Leider half auch alles löschen/komplett neu installieren nichts. Der Fehler bleibt.
Der Newsgroupeintrag ist wenig hilfreich, da er noch nicht beantwortet wurde.

alphaflight83 28. Okt 2011 10:59

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Ich war mir bei dem Pidgin-English nicht sicher, dachte aber, dass das die Lösung war ...
Zitat:

I have located that have installed dclDataSnapIndy10ServerTransport120.bpl.
I delete. I compile my project properly and works well.
... also, dass noch Zusatzpackages installiert sind, die auf die Anderen/Alten verweisen.

(Kann aber auch sein, dass das nur als weitere Erläuterung zum Problem gedacht war)

LeisureSuitLarry 28. Okt 2011 11:13

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Diese Datei gibt es bei mir nicht...
Nächste Woche werde ich mich wohl intensiver darum kümmern müssen

LeisureSuitLarry 3. Nov 2011 13:36

AW: [DCC Fataler Fehler] E2202 Package 'IndyCore' wird benötigt
 
Problem gelöst.
Nachdem die Meldung auch bei Projekten auftauchte, die kein Indy verwenden, habe ich mich an ein Problem erinnert, das ich schon einmal hatte.

Unter Projekt-Optionen/Packages Laufzeitpackages verwenden, rechtsklick auf ...

Dort war Indycore und Indyprotocols eingetragen.

Gelöscht, Indy neu erzeugt... alles passt.


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:06 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z